<script lang="ts">
  import { createEventDispatcher, tick, getContext } from "svelte";

  import { upload_files, upload, FileData } from "@gradio/client";
  import LoadingSpinner from "./loading_spinner.svelte";
  let uploaded_files;
  const dispatch = createEventDispatcher();
  const upload_fn = getContext<typeof upload_files>("upload_files");
  export let root: string;
  async function handle_upload(file_data: FileData): Promise<void> {
    await tick();
    const upload_id = Math.random().toString(36).substring(2, 15);
    uploaded_files = await upload([file_data], root, upload_id, upload_fn);
    dispatch("load", uploaded_files[0]);
  }
  let loading = false;
  async function fetchFromDB(identifier, database): Promise<void> {
    let dbs = {
      pdb_assym: {
        url: "https://files.rcsb.org/view/",
        ext: ".pdb",
      },
      pdb_bioass: {
        url: "https://files.rcsb.org/view/",
        ext: ".pdb1",
      },
      af: {
        url: "https://alphafold.ebi.ac.uk/files/AF-",
        ext: "-F1-model_v4.pdb",
      },
      esm: {
        url: "https://api.esmatlas.com/fetchPredictedStructure/",
        ext: ".pdb",
      },
      // pubchem: "pubchem",
      // text: "text",
    };
    let url = dbs[database]["url"];
    let ext = dbs[database]["ext"];
    // load the file and save blob
    // emulate file upload by fetching from the db and triggering upload
    // check if response status is 200, then return blob
    loading = true;
    let file = null;
    try {
      file = await fetch(url + identifier + ext)
        .then((r) => {
          loading = false;
          if (r.status == 200) {
            return r.blob();
          } else {
            dispatch("notfound");
          }
        })
        .then((blob) => {
          return new File([blob], identifier + ".pdb", { type: "text/plain" });
        });
    } catch (error) {
      loading = false;
      dispatch("notfound");
    }
    let file_data = new FileData({
      path: identifier + ".pdb",
      orig_name: identifier + ".pdb",
      blob: file,
      size: file.size,
      mime_type: file.type,
      is_stream: false,
    });
    await handle_upload(file_data);
  }
  let selectedValue = "pdb_assym";
  let placeholder = "";
  let textInput = "";
  function handleSelect(event) {
    selectedValue = event.target.value;
  }
  let placeholders = {
    pdb_assym: "Enter PDB identifier",
    pdb_bioass: "Enter PDB identifier",
    af: "Enter UniProt identifier",
    esm: "Enter MGnify protein identifier",
    // pubchem: "Enter PubChem identifier",
    // text: "Enter molecule in PDB or mol2 format",
  };
  $: placeholder = placeholders[selectedValue];
  function isEnterPressed(event) {
    if (event.key === "Enter") {
      fetchFromDB(textInput, selectedValue);
    }
  }
</script>
